嘿,各位网站开发的小伙伴们,你们有没有遇到过这样的烦恼?网站轮播图制作起来总是头疼,既要保证美观又要确保高效。其实,掌握一些高效代码技巧,轻松就能搞定网站轮播,今天就来给大家分享一下我的经验。
首先,我们要了解的是,网站轮播图的核心就是通过JavaScript和CSS来实现动态效果。而在这个基础上,我们可以利用一些现成的轮播图插件来简化开发过程。比如说,Bootstrap、Swiper这些框架都提供了丰富的轮播图组件,可以快速搭建出美观且高效的轮播效果。
当然,如果你是追求个性化的开发者,那么自己编写轮播图代码也是一种不错的选择。下面,我就来分享几个高效代码技巧,帮助大家轻松掌握。
1. 使用CSS3实现动画效果
其实,CSS3已经为我们提供了很多实用的动画效果,比如:过渡(transition)、动画(animation)等。利用这些效果,我们可以轻松实现轮播图的切换动画,不仅代码简洁,而且性能优越。
比如,我们可以使用CSS的`transform`属性来实现轮播图的平移效果。在切换图片时,只需要改变图片的位置即可,无需修改其他样式。这样一来,不仅代码简洁,而且性能也得到了提升。
2. 利用JavaScript实现自动播放和手动切换
自动播放是轮播图的一个重要功能,而实现这个功能的关键就是JavaScript。我们可以通过设置定时器来模拟自动播放,当用户进行手动切换时,则清除定时器,从而实现手动控制播放。
这里有一个小技巧:我们可以使用`setInterval`函数来设置定时器,当用户点击切换按钮时,清除定时器,并在切换完成后重新设置定时器。这样,就可以实现自动播放和手动切换的完美结合。
3. 注意性能优化
在编写轮播图代码时,我们还需要注意性能优化。以下是一些常见的优化方法:
- 图片懒加载:当用户滚动到图片位置时,再加载图片,减少初始加载时间。
- 使用CSS3的`will-change`属性:预加载即将变化的属性,提高动画性能。
- 合理使用CSS选择器:避免使用过多的后代选择器和复杂的选择器,减少浏览器的渲染时间。
总结一下,掌握一些高效代码技巧,轻松就能搞定网站轮播。当然,这只是一个起点,随着技术的不断发展,相信会有更多优秀的轮播图解决方案出现。希望这篇文章能对大家有所帮助,让我们一起努力,打造更加优秀的网站吧!
转载请注明来自艺唯思号,本文标题:《网站轮播不再头疼 轻松掌握高效代码技巧》













京公网安备11000000000001号
京ICP备11000001号
还没有评论,来说两句吧...